Foster, Santa Clara defeat Bethune-Cookman 75-61

The Columbian
Published: November 22, 2010, 12:00am

SANTA CLARA, Calif. (AP) — Kevin Foster hit a career-high six 3-pointers and scored 21 points and three other Santa Clara players finished in double figures as the Broncos defeated Bethune-Cookman 75-61 in the Las Vegas Invitational on Sunday night.

Evan Roquemore and Marc Trasolini added 13 points each and Ben Dowdell had 10 for the Broncos (3-1).

C. J. Reed led the Wildcats (2-1) with 29 points, and Dion Holloman scored 11.

Santa Clara trailed 29-27 at halftime before pulling away with a 25-10 run for a 65-52 lead with 2:46 to play.

The Broncos made 15 of 19 shots in the second half and shot 56.8 percent overall, including 9 of 18 from 3-point range.

Santa Clara outrebounded Bethune-Cookman 31-22.
